Subscribe for the latest news from SNTV: bit.ly Taiwan’s sister-pair Chan Yung-Jan and Chan Hao-Ching won their first WTA title in the inaugural WTA event Shenzhen Open after beating Irina Buryachok of the Ukraine and Valeria Solovieva of Russia 6-0, 7-5 on Saturday (5th January).
